Understanding Clay Sewer Line Issues

Clay sewer pipes were widely used in older homes because of their durability, availability, and resistance to chemical corrosion. While they were a reliable choice for decades, these pipes over time can become faulty and are now prone to issues that can lead to expensive plumbing problems.

Recognizing the common challenges associated with clay pipes can help homeowners determine when repairs are needed and when full sewer line replacement is the best option.

Common Problems with Terracotta Pipes

  • Tree Root Intrusion: The joints in clay pipes create small openings where tree roots can grow, causing severe blockages and potential pipe damage.
  • Cracks and Breaks: Over time, clay pipes may become brittle and can develop cracks, leading to leaks and soil contamination.
  • Shifting and Misalignment: Changes in soil conditions and natural ground movement can result in clay pipes shifting or disconnecting, leading to drainage problems.

When to Repair vs. Replace

  • Minor Cracks and Localized Damage: This can often be repaired with pipe relining or spot replacements.
  • Extensive Root Invasion or Large Fractures: This situation usually requires full pipe replacement for long-term durability.
  • Severely Misaligned or Collapsed Pipes: This may necessitate trenchless pipe bursting or a complete sewer line replacement.

Assessing the severity of the damage through a sewer line inspection is key to determining the best course of action.

Steps to Repair a Clay Sewer Line

  1. Diagnosing the Problem: Use a sewer camera inspection to identify the damage. This will determine whether a pipe section needs to be repaired or if all drain pipes are damaged.
  2. Digging to Access the Pipe: Locate the exact location of the clay sewer line and dig a trench to expose the damaged section or sections. It’s necessary to consider the depth and complexity of excavation, which may require specialized equipment or assistance from a plumbing professional.
  3. Repair Methods: This is where it can get tricky and present challenges for homeowners, as there are multiple options, which include:
  • Spot Repairs for Minor Damage: Remove the damaged clay pipes and replace them with PVC pipes or new clay pipe. Use rubber couplings or no-hub connectors to join old and new pipes.
  • Pipe Lining for Moderate Damage: Insert a resin-coated liner inside the existing pipes to seal cracks and leaks. The benefit here is that this approach is less invasive and extends the lifetime of the pipes.
  • Pipe Bursting for Severe Damage: Insert a new pipe while breaking apart the old clay pipe. This, in turn, replaces the entire line without extensive digging.

DIY Repair Challenges for Homeowners

Engaging in clay sewer pipe repairs on your own may seem like a way to save money, but the process is physically demanding and requires specialized tools. Without expert clay sewer pipe assistance from a professional plumber, DIY repairs can lead to costly mistakes and even safety hazards.

Here are some key challenges for homeowners to consider:

  • Heavy Labor and Equipment: Digging to access the clay pipes and cutting them up requires professional-grade tools that most homeowners don’t have access to.
  • Risk of Further Pipe Damage: Incorrect or faulty repairs can cause leaks, misaligned pipes, structural damage, or persistent blockages, which leads to bigger plumbing problems.
  • Permit and Code Requirements: Many areas, including in Indianapolis, require permits and sewer line inspections. Improper or unauthorized work may violate local plumbing codes.
  • Health and Safety Risks: Handling sewage, dirty water, or damaged pipes can expose you, as a property owner, to bacteria, mold, foul odors, and harmful gases.

For durable and long-lasting solutions, hiring experienced plumbers is often the safest and most cost-effective option.
